Hi,

On the Raven, the targets banks are a bit special : indeed there is no traditional "banks" implemented like walls, but four individuals targets acting more like gates (rollover targets). So, there is four "single target" banks. As usual, a target bank can be reset (target raised), but also trip (target downed). The reset function is made using a "big" coil (A-18102) and the drop function is made using a small "flat" coil (A-19508, located inside the bank).

As usual , as there is not enough outputs on the driver board, the main coils (A-18102) are driven by SOLENOID outputs (#1, #2, #5 and #6). While the little coils (A-19508) are driven by lamps outputs (L12, L13, L14 and L15).

As the drop function works on all banks, this means that the L12...L15 outputs works fine, but also that the fuses F10 and F11 are OK.
As the issue is only on the left side, the culprit should be SOLENOID #1 and #5, that are not working.

But first : check if your Raven wiring is original (because, sometimes people add extra-fuses on coils lines).

May be, this is only a bad contact problem. Check the A3J4 (on the driver board), try to plug/unplug it (of course, with power off !).
The worst case, the driver board is defective (and no more drive SOL #1 and SOL #5). In this case, probably the 2N3055 (Q58 & Q62) are burned.
If you have a spare driver board, try a swap.

◾At the game start, the four "snippers" goes down.
◾During game, when the snipper sequence is activated, the "snippers" appears and disappears randomly.
◾At the end of the game, the four "snippers" goes up (and thus are all visible while the attract mode).

→ During the snipper sequence, only one "snipper" target is raised at a time, and remain active for some seconds, then it is retracted. When the "snipper" is up, the orange triangle light in front will flash. Hitting a "snipper" award 50.000 points, and the orange light remain lighted (to indicate that this snipper has already been hit).

→ To activate the snipper sequence, this depend of the selection of the DIP switch 31 (easy/difficult), either :
↠ complete the bottom left or right, 3 targets bank (in easy mode)
↠ complete the bottom 6 targets bank (in difficult mode)
The hit targets have their white triangle light off (otherwise, it is flashing)

→ For the SPECIAL, this depend of the selection of the DIP switch 32 (easy/difficult), either :
↠ shoot 3 "snippers" (in easy mode)
↠ shoot 4 "snippers" (in difficult mode)

Note also, that the TEST mode on SYS80B is "intelligent" :
- as the lamps L12...L15 are used for coils, they are not tested during the lamp test.
- but, during the solenoids test, they are activated and also the SOL #1, #2, #5, #6.
This allows to see the all 4 snipper targets to move up/down.
